We went to the Saint-O for business lunch with two clients. We had a quick lunch but ended up staying a few hours. A friendly relaxed location away from the trendy hub-hub. The food is very good, the portions filling and the staff professional.

I took my mother to Le Saint O for lunch on Friday. The atmosphere was perfect for a leisurely lunch, although the menu does include dishes for people in a hurry. The service was impeccable: attentive yet unobtrusive. A delightful restaurant to which I shall most certainly return.
